Before you make reservations at particular hotels in Bend, Or, check its reviews on websites like TripAdvisor. These provide you with first-hand information about people's recent experiences at each hotel. Reading other people's reviews of the hotels you're considering can really help you decide which one to choose.

Use sensible safety and security precautions when you are looking for lodging in Bend, Oregon. Find out where all the fire exits are in case of an emergency. Also, note where the nearby fire extinguishers are located. If you have any valuables, keep them in the safe at the desk or in the room.

To keep your drinking water clean in a hotel room, rinse out your drinking glasses, even if there is a paper cover or a plastic wrapping around it. Dust and debris from the plastic can settle in the glass, leading to an unpleasant first sip. Taking the time to rinse it out will make your experience better.

When traveling with children, be sure the hotels you choose offer features the kids will enjoy. A playground on site is very helpful. A pool with plenty of shallow area and/or a kiddie pool will provide great play time. Also check to see if the hotel you are interested in offers a child care service.

Verify the check-in time at the hotel. If you show up too early for check-in, then your room may not be ready for you yet. Call the hotel if you are early and find out if your room is ready.

It can be hard to know how to select good hotels. Joining a travel club can be a very smart choice if you do a lot of traveling. Your travel club will provide you with hotel guide materials. Representatives can answer your questions, help you choose hotels and even help you plan and book your reservations.

Avoid using the phone in the hotel to make any calls. If you do not have a mobile phone, it would be a good idea to purchase a prepaid phone to make calls during your stay. The only exception should be if free local calls are included in the room rate.

If you want to work on saving the environment, a green vacation is something to look into. There are plenty of "green" hotels that take the environment into consideration. Green certification is something some of the newly built hotels are quite proud of promoting. Older hotels might change practices to be greener. Check online or ask a travel agent for help.

If you plan on using any glasses from the hotel minibar, make sure that you wash them first. Even if they appear to be clean, they may have been wiped with a chemical cleaner. Many housekeeping staff use the same products that they use to clean windows and mirrors on those glasses.

Sign on to Facebook and find the page of the hotel you are staying at. Write a little message on their page, and see if the staff responds. You never know, they may offer you a special perk! If nothing else, keep up with what is happening on the page in case any specials are announced.
